MAIN PURPOSE
As a key member of local Security, Health & Safety Team and subject expert within the country, you are responsible for assisting the local management and Regional Security Team with the implementation and management of the Regional Security strategy, Group Directives, standards, guidelines and programs. Identifying, developing, implementing protection and security processes across the Korea business units to reduce security related risks, respond to incidents and limit exposure to liability in all areas related to Physical Security.
Provide expertise, direction and support on all matters relating to physical security and health & safety, security risk identification, analysis and applied mitigation measures, security awareness.
KEY RESPONSIBILITIES
Physical security responsibilities
• Establish security concept in retail locations, distribution center & technical center in compliance with Group Security Directives – communication with respective stakeholders in area analysis, risk identification & assessment, design mitigation measures, security zoning, operation flow review for persons & goods, guide & execute security construction measures & deploy alarm plan as well as electronic security equipment
• Security compliance – Upon boutique visit once a year, operation review thoroughly and advice local security operating procedure, supplement physical security aspects and amend security procedure, implement matrix for access level management & control, boutique visits once a year and produce visit reports and follow up, security communications & alerts for incidents & near misses, event site survey, event declaration to regional team for Security concept validation
• External 3rd party management – plan alarm & CCTV maintenance program, cost analysis & saving plans on monthly expenses, regularly meet for quality improvement, KPI set up & contract review, review daily alarm response reports, security guards SOP set up, seek for win-win relationship with external partners in problem solving & enhancements
• Incident management – report incidents in the Group ware within local & regional organization, investigation & interview with respective parties, cooperate with police in necessary, insurance declaration for indemnification, recommendations and establish preventive measures
• Security training – security awareness training arrangement, training on group security directives, valuable goods hand carrier training, security retail training, security audit preparation & compliance review, gap analysis against the company’s security safety standards, internal security audit follow up
• Coordinate the Security, Health & Safety committee in distribution centre, customer services
Health & Safety responsibilities
• Gap analysis with group directives and implement necessary measures
• Yearly plan on cross-functional projects on health & safety engagements with related departments & estimation for expected costs
• Health & safety Incident reports, investigation, follow up & preventives measures communication, generate quarterly health & safety reports
• Overview and provide assistance to occupational health & safety committee
